Men's and women's basketball schedules set

12:40 p.m., Aug. 13, 2003--The 2003-04 UD men and women’s basketball schedules have been released, with each team slated to play 13 regular season home games.

The men begin the season with an away game against Mt. St. Mary’s Nov. 25, followed by the home opener against San Francisco Nov. 30. The other nonconference teams on the men’s schedule are Long Island, UMBC, Loyola, Rider, Siena and St. Joseph’s.

The women open the season with a home game against Richmond Nov. 21. The other nonconference teams will be Brown, Fairfield or Massachusetts, La Salle, Navy, St. John’s, Loyola and Manhattan.

The Lady Hens had their fourth consecutive 20-win season last year, finishing with a record of 22-9 (15-3 CAA). They lost in the CAA finals to Old Dominion. Two starters return from last year’s team, including second-team all-conference selection Tiara Malcom.

The men were 15-14 last year, losing in the CAA semifinals to eventual-champion UNC Wilmington. They return four starters from that team, including the backcourt of Mike Slattery and Mike Ames, candidates for All-CAA and Academic All-America.

Single-game tickets go on sale Monday, Nov. 3. Season tickets are on sale now.
